16. Discrimination according to sexual direction

Delwin Vriend worked as the a lab planner in the a college during the Edmonton, Alberta. His sexual direction failed to conform to the fresh college’s plan to your homosexuality. Vriend desired to make a complaint towards the Alberta People Rights Fee that their employer had discriminated up against your. However, Alberta’s human legal rights guidelines did not tend to be sexual orientation as a great prohibited ground of discrimination.

Vriend argued you to definitely failing continually to were sexual direction as a banned floor regarding discrimination infringed his equality legal rights. The Supreme Court agreed and confirmed that sexual positioning was a good blocked ground out-of discrimination according to the Rental, while it’s not especially listed. The Legal read within the terminology “sexual positioning” into directory of prohibited grounds from the Alberta legislation.

This example is essential for many different explanations, also their conversation out-of exactly how even individual rights rules can get violate equivalence legal rights once they fail to cover certain groups of someone that have typically already been discriminated against.

17. Equality legal rights to possess exact same-sex partners

Yards. looked for spousal support underneath the Loved ones Law Act immediately following their unique same-sex matchmaking finished. The newest operate laid out a partner since the somebody who was legally hitched or a single man or woman who have lived that have a person in the contrary sex for around three years.

Meters. stated that the work violated their unique equality legal rights since it handled opposite-sex une-sex single partners. The fresh new Ultimate Court discovered that new work discriminated facing members of same-sex relationships. The latest work meant one to the relationship was in fact smaller rewarding, reduced value identification much less well worth courtroom security than simply new matchmaking out of reverse-sex partners. Which denial regarding man’s equivalence and you can self-esteem real Balaklava women dating regarding the eyes from regulations is what this new Charter is supposed to protect up against.

18. A straight to your state-funded attorneys if authorities tries to get rid of a child out of their particular parent’s infant custody

The latest Brunswick Minister out of Heath and you can Community Qualities are granted custody out-of Ms. G’s around three people to possess a six-week several months. This new Minister wanted to offer the newest infant custody acquisition for the next half dozen weeks. The children’s mother planned to go to courtroom to argue up against the fresh infant custody buy expansion, but could perhaps not afford to hire a legal professional. She removed judge support lower than The fresh new Brunswick’s Residential Judge Assistance System, but was refused while the at the time the applying failed to shelter the expense of lawyers within the infant custody cases.

Ms. G challenged the brand new provincial legal aid program, arguing which broken their unique right to safeguards of the individual as the reading wouldn’t be reasonable when the she don’t has actually courtroom symbol. The latest Finest Judge decided, discovering that in the event the government takes away an infant out-of a grandfather, this leads to really stress, stigma and rupture of your father or mother-youngster bond it inhibits the parent’s coverage of individual. This is why the fresh Charter claims the fresh father or mother a directly to a reasonable reading in these instances, which could want legal logo with the father or mother. In which the instance comes to complicated affairs or judge disagreement and you may in which the latest mother or father cannot afford a lawyer, the federal government need to pay toward parent’s courtroom logo.
